Pyrus communis L.

NO: Pære; pæretre

SE: Päron

DK: Pære

FI: Päärynäpuu

DE: Birnbaum

EN: Pear

 

An ancient domesticated fruit tree, P. communis is native to Europe and southwest Asia. Although most pear trees are cultivated, wild pears are not uncommon and in the Nordic countries tend to occur in lowland deciduous forests.

 

Specimen collected and photographed near Oslo, Norway 15 Apr 2007 from a wild form.
